Solution-processed Zinc Oxide Thin Film as an Electron Extraction Layer in Polymer Solar Cells with an Inverted Device Structure

摘      要:Solution-processed zinc oxide(ZnO) thin film as an electron extraction layer in polymer solar cells(PSCs) with an inverted device structure has been *** improvement in power conversion efficiency (PCE) from 1.21%to 3.50%,fill factor(FF) from 0.37 to 0.62,open-circuit voltage(Voc ) from 0.43 V to 0.58V and short-circuit current density(Jsc) from 6.13mA/cm to 7.07mA/cm are observed from PSCs with ZnO
